Buying Guide for the Best Thick Duvet Insert

Choosing the right thick duvet insert can significantly impact your sleep quality and comfort. A thick duvet insert is designed to provide warmth and coziness, making it ideal for colder climates or those who prefer a snug sleeping environment. When selecting a duvet insert, it's important to consider various factors such as fill material, fill power, weight, and size to ensure you get the best fit for your needs.
Fill MaterialThe fill material of a duvet insert determines its warmth, weight, and overall feel. Common fill materials include down, down alternative, wool, and synthetic fibers. Down is known for its excellent insulation and lightweight feel, making it a popular choice for those seeking luxurious comfort. Down alternative is a hypoallergenic option that mimics the feel of down but is often more affordable. Wool is naturally breathable and moisture-wicking, making it a good choice for regulating temperature. Synthetic fibers are durable and easy to care for, making them suitable for those with allergies or who prefer low-maintenance bedding. Choose a fill material based on your personal preferences, allergies, and desired level of warmth.
Fill PowerFill power measures the loft or fluffiness of the down in a duvet insert and is an indicator of its insulating ability. Higher fill power means better insulation and a lighter duvet for the same level of warmth. Fill power typically ranges from 400 to 900. A fill power of 400-500 is considered good, 600-700 is very good, and 800-900 is excellent. If you live in a very cold climate or prefer a very warm duvet, opt for a higher fill power. For milder climates or if you tend to sleep hot, a lower fill power may be more suitable.
WeightThe weight of a duvet insert refers to how heavy it feels and is often categorized as lightweight, medium weight, or heavyweight. Lightweight duvets are ideal for warmer climates or those who prefer a less heavy cover. Medium weight duvets offer a balance of warmth and comfort, making them suitable for most seasons and sleepers. Heavyweight duvets provide maximum warmth and are best for very cold climates or those who enjoy a substantial, cozy feel. Consider your local climate and personal comfort preferences when choosing the weight of your duvet insert.
SizeDuvet inserts come in various sizes to fit different bed dimensions, including twin, full, queen, and king. It's important to choose a size that matches your bed to ensure proper coverage and comfort. Additionally, some people prefer a slightly larger duvet for extra drape and coziness. Measure your bed and consider your sleeping habits (e.g., if you share the bed and need more coverage) to select the right size. A well-fitting duvet insert will enhance your sleep experience by providing consistent warmth and comfort throughout the night.
Thread CountThread count refers to the number of threads per square inch of fabric and affects the softness and durability of the duvet cover. A higher thread count typically means a softer and more durable fabric. Thread counts for duvet inserts usually range from 200 to 800. A thread count of 200-400 is considered good and provides a balance of softness and breathability. A thread count of 400-600 is very good and offers a smoother, more luxurious feel. A thread count of 600-800 is excellent and provides the highest level of softness and durability. Choose a thread count based on your preference for fabric feel and durability.
